EGS Swayed To The Music… Jazz & Acoustic Vibes

12th May 2022Mrs S Field

A very enjoyable Jazz and Acoustic Evening was held on Friday, 6th May with many of our school bands taking part, our choir and also some great performances from staff.

Special thanks to Miss Paula Thompson who sang a Bossa Nova number and to Mr David Hammer who played his vibraphone – an instrument we have not heard at school for some years.

It was a very informal and relaxed evening with a great atmosphere in the Hall – thanks to Mr Ness for those lights!

Thanks also to FEGS for running the bar and – of course, to all the students who performed and their friends and families who came to support them.

Our next Concert will be our Summer Music Soiree on Friday 8th July.

Battle of the Bands 2022

4th April 2022Mrs S Field

The Battle of the Bands finally returned to the EGS stage on Friday, 25th March – the last Battle being fought in March 2019!

All our school bands performed brilliantly during the evening together with two student-led bands.

Awards were made for the best guitarist, drummer, bass player, singer and for featured instruments and the final winner was The Apprentice Band, who received the silver trophy at the end of the evening.

A huge thank you to Hannah Stratton who was our judge for this event, to our tutors who led the bands – Mr Tate-Lovery, Mr Escott and Mr Waters – to all our parents for supporting the bands so enthusiastically and, of course, to all the students who took part.  You made us very proud.

The next music event is the Jazz and Acoustic evening on Friday, 6th May

KS3 Music Concert Cancelled :-(

7th February 2022Mrs S Field

It is with great regret that the Key Stage 3 Concert due to take place on 25th February has been cancelled.

The Concert takes place to showcase the talents of Years 7 – 9 and especially to give all the Year 7 students the opportunity to sing together in a mass choir.  Because of the Covid restrictions in place until very recently, it has not been possible to run singing rehearsals in our Year 7 classes and so preparation for this Concert could not take place.  We are very sorry for the disappointment this will cause both our students and you.

However, the Year 7, Year 8 and Year 9 bands will have an opportunity to perform in the Battle of the Bands which is fixed for Friday 25th March.  Any students who were hoping to perform solos or duets in the Key Stage 3 Concert should come and see me with a view to performing in either the Jazz and Acoustic Evening or at the Summer Music Soiree.

If any Year 7 student would like to sing in school, they are most welcome to join our Choir which rehearses every Wednesday lunchtime in Room C1 under Miss Paula Thompson.  Individual singing lessons with Miss Thompson are also available (£145 per term).

Once again, my apologies for the cancellation of this event.  We are very much hoping that this will be the last event we will have to cancel because of Covid restrictions.
